If you own an iPhone, iPad or even a Mac prepare for us to show you how to streamline the process and make the tracking numbers work for you, not the other way around. We present to you--Delivery Status touch [iTunes Link].
Delivery Status touch is not only available on the iPhone, iPod Touch or iPad app; users can also download an OS X widget that mimics the iOS app's functionality. Going even one step further, by visiting Junecloud.com users can sign up for a free account that will sync packages between all apps mentioned previously.
The cost of Delivery Status touch is $4.99, which will give you both the iPhone (or iPod Touch) as well as the iPad version. The OS X widget is free of charge, along with the Junecloud Sync account required to sync tracked packages across multiple devices.
Entering a tracking number can be as easy as scanning a barcode with your iPhone camera, or entering your Amazon account information and allowing the app to begin tracking before your items ever even ship.
